Common Login Hurdles and Solutions

Even the most seasoned players occasionally run into minor snags. The most frequent issue is a forgotten password. Fortunately, the “Forgot Password” link on the login screen initiates a simple reset process. You will receive a link via your registered email to create a new, secure password. Another common scenario is account lockout after multiple failed attempts. This is a protective measure designed to stop brute-force attacks. Typically, you will need to wait a short period or contact customer support to reinstate access.

It is also worth noting that browser cache or cookies can sometimes cause login errors. A quick solution is to clear your browsing data or try a different browser. If problems persist, the support team is usually reachable via live chat for immediate assistance.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: What should I do if I cannot remember my username?
A: Contact customer support directly with the email address you used during registration. They can verify your identity and retrieve your username securely.

Q: Is it safe to save my login details on my personal computer?
A: For your own private device, it is generally acceptable. However, avoid saving credentials on shared or public computers, and always log out completely after your session.

Q: How do I enable two-factor authentication on my account?
A: Navigate to the account settings or security section after logging in. Look for the 2FA option and follow the on-screen instructions to link your mobile device.

Q: Can I change my registered email address?
A: Yes, but this change often requires verification. You may need to provide identification documents to ensure the request is legitimate and to prevent fraud.

Q: What happens if I accidentally lock my account?
A: Most lockouts are temporary and last between 15 to 30 minutes. If access is not restored, reaching out to live chat support is the fastest way to unlock your account manually.

Q: Does the casino ever ask for my password via email or phone?
A: Never. Legitimate support teams will never request your password. If you receive such a request, report it immediately as a potential phishing attempt.
